Development of a Acoustic Acquisition Prototype device and System Modules for Fire Detection in the Underground Utility Tunnel (지하 공동구 화재재난 감지를 위한 음향수집 프로토타입 장치 및 시스템 모듈 개발)

  • Since the direct and indirect damage caused by the fire in the underground utility tunnel will cause great damage to society as a whole, it is necessary to make efforts to prevent and control it in advance. The most of the fires that occur in cables are caused by short circuits, earth leakage, ignition due to over-current, overheating of conductor connections, and ignition due to sparks caused by breakdown of insulators. In order to find the cause of fire at an early stage due to the characteristics of the underground utility tunnel and to prevent disasters and safety accidents, we are constantly managing it with a detection system using image analysis and making efforts. Among them, a case of developing a fire detection system using CCTV-based deep learning image analysis technology has been reported. However, CCTV needs to be supplemented because there are blind spots. Therefore, we would like to develop a high-performance acoustic-based deep learning model that can prevent fire by detecting the spark sound before spark occurs. In this study, we propose a method that can collect sound in underground utility tunnel environments using microphone sensor through development and experiment of prototype module. After arranging an acoustic sensor in the underground utility tunnel with a lot of condensation, it verifies whether data can be collected in real time without malfunction.

The Newly changed Painting's Aesthetic of Seonbi painter Yoon DeokHee and Yun Yong Father and Son (선비화가 윤덕희(尹德熙)·윤용(尹愹) 부자(父子)의 변유적(變維的) 회화심미(繪畵審美) 고찰)

  • The three generations of Haenam Yoon, who have been handed down to Gongjae Yoon DuSeo (1668~1715), Yoon DeokHee (1685~1776) and Yoon Yong (1708~1740), were based in Haenam. They had an artistic soul on the stage of Hanyang and succeeded in the art of the family, building a reputation as a family of Seonbi painters representing the late Joseon Dynasty. Born as the eldest son of Gongjae and lived at the age of 82, Rakseo learned a variety of studies, calligraphy and painting from his father and Lee Seo. While learning the paintings of the early and mid Joseon period, and accepting the Namjong painting method, he pursued the realism and three-dimensional sense of the subject by adding a Western-style shading method. In particular, he showed outstanding talent in horse paintings and pottery figures, expressing his original 'Beauty that realistically portrays real scenery'. Cheonggo, who was born as the second son of Rakseo and died at the age of 32, was good at Namjong landscape painting using various tree drawing methods. He painted the original Siuido by changing the topical poems, as well as detailed observations and explorations to accurately describe the facts of the object. In addition, 'Beauty showing affection through realistic scenery' was expressed by newly changing and reinterpreting the tendency of home appliances painting to express the spirit as a form beyond the realistic landscape. Rakseo and Cheonggo father and son made a 'NogUdang' painting style, drastically changing the paintings of the late Joseon Dynasty, and had a great influence on the history of Korean painting.

Sinjungsin Mask Play Study (신중신탈놀이 연구)

  • Sinjungsin Mask Play, one of Ttangseolbeop, is related to Seongjusin's life story. Sinjungsin Mask Play is a reconstruction of the story of the folk gods Seongjusin met while returning home. Seongjusin's life story proceeds in the form of Mask Play, and the monk who leads the sermon plays narration and main roles. Many believers play various roles and musicians. Sinjungsin Mask Play introduces many folk beliefs, sounds for intrigue, and talks. Sinjungsin Mask Play uses the same method of enumeration and repetition as the existing Mask Play. The repetition of a sentence or phrase plays a role in foreseeing the meaning of the context or foretelling the development of the plot to the audience. This repetition is intended to emphasize the situation of the scene and to create rhythm. Since Mask Play was exclusively for the common people, Mask Play actors use the repeating method commonly used in folk songs to form lines. This gives the audience a familiarity, effectively communicating the lines and responding to their tastes. Sinjungsin Mask Play borrowed people's way of playing for the public's mission. It inherits the dramatic forms of traditional traditional plays such as repetition of words or sentences or phrases, codification of words or sentences, borrowing of existing songs, and formal expression units. In addition, through repeated performances, believers can easily and easily learn and understand. This is the dramatic form and characteristics of Sinjungsin Mask Play. Sinjungsin Mask Play was handed down from Faith Communities and was used as a means of folk cultivation to spread illegality. Buddhism externalizes the process of accepting folk beliefs through Mask Play, and in the case of Shinto who participated directly or indirectly, they naturally acquire the belief system of Hwaeom Kyung through play. Sinjungsin Mask Play, one of Ttangseolbeop, can be said to have great value as an ICH, as well as popularization and mission.

Application of New Measurement Method for Improvement of Rock Joint Roughness Underestimation (암석 절리면 거칠기 과소평가의 개선을 위한 새로운 측정방법의 적용)

  • Many methods have been tried to more correctly measure rock joint roughness. However, true roughness may be distorted and underestimated due to the sampling interval and measurement method. Thus, currently used measurement methods produce a dead zone and distort roughness profiles. The purpose of this study is to suggest new roughness measurement method by a camera-type 3D scanner as an alternative of currently used methods. First, the underestimation of artificial roughness is analyzed by using the current measurement method such as laser profilometry. Second, we replicate eight specimens from two rock joint surfaces, and digitize by a 3D scanner. Then, the roughness coefficient values obtained from eight numbers of 3D surface data and from three hundred twenty numbers of 2D profiles data are analyzed by using current and new measurement methods. The artificial simulation confirms that the sampling interval is one of main factors for the distortion of roughness and shows that inclination of waviness may not be considered any current methods. The experimental results show that the camera-type 3D scanner produces 10% larger roughness values than current methods. As the proposed new method is a fast, high precision and more accurate method for the roughness measurement, it should be a promising technique in this area.

Comparison between South Korean and Taiwanese college culture: Focusing on the Hierarchical Sexist Influence of Military Culture (한국과 대만의 대학문화 비교 : 위계와 성차별, 폭력의 군대적 징후를 중심으로)

  • This study has compared South Korea with Taiwan, a society which has an almost non-hierarchical college culture in spite of its social and historical similarities to Korea, including the recruit system. By the means of quantitative and qualitative comparative studies and analysis, it has tried to clarify the reasons behind the hierarchical and sexist military culture of Korean universities. According to the comparative studies, Taiwan's college culture is less hierarchical than that of South Korea, and support for the necessity of hierarchy is weaker. Hierarchy had a greater influence on the payment of meals, appellations and society admissions in South Korea. Elements of military culture such as violence or group discipline were usually only present in South Korean college culture. Male-centered drinking and prostitution culture was also found to be stronger in South Korea. The historical and social reason for these differences is that Taiwan has a weaker basis for nationalism and militarism, both essential factors in the founding of hierarchical and collective culture. The most direct reason for the lack of hierarchy in Taiwanese college culture is the period of recruitment. In South Korea, young men usually apply for military service during the first or second year or college, and return to school as second or third-year studies. In Taiwan, however, men are usually recruited after having graduated from college. Students who have served in the army have proved to have a significant influence on violence, hierarchy and drinking culture in Korea's college culture. South Korea's college culture has two main problems. The first is that South Korean college students are not able to be critical towards the harms of South Korea's oppressively hierarchical collective culture, and therefore do not develop the strength to fight against it. This is all the more problematic because they are the future components of South Korea's main institutions. The second is that it roots male-centeredness even further into the South Korean mentality.

Income Inequality of the Aged: Trends and Factor Decomposition (노인 소득의 불평등 추이와 불평등 요인분)

  • The primary purpose of this study is to find policy implications by examining the trends in income inequality of the Korean aged and factors contributing to these. For analysis, this study used the 2nd, 5th, 7th and 9th wave of 'Korean Labour and Income Panel Study'. The findings are as follows. First, total income inequality of the elderly rose greatly after 1998 and is decreasing after 2001. Secondly, the Gini coefficient decomposition by income sources shows that earned income was the factor most responsible for the income inequality of the elderly. But its influences of the elderly income inequality is gradually decreasing during analysing periods. Third, assets income and public pensions have a great effects on the elderly income inequality. They increases the income inequality of the elderly households. Forth, interfamily transfer income and public assistance income reduces income inequality of the elderly.

Research on simple measurement method of floor finishing materials to predict lightweight floor impact noise reduction performance in apartment houses (공동주택 경량 바닥충격음 저감성능 예측을 위한 바닥마감재 간이측정 방법 연구)

  • To date, research on heavy floor impact noise has mainly been conducted. The reason is that in the case of lightweight floor impact noise, sufficient performance could be secured with only the floating floor structure and floor finishing materials. In the case of heavy floor impact noise in a floating floor structure, the reduction performance can be predicted to some extent by measuring the dynamic elasticity of the floor cushioning material. However, with the recent introduction of the post-measurement system, various floor structures are being developed. In particular, many non-floating floor structures that do not use cushioning materials are being developed. In floor structures where cushioning materials are not used, the finishing material will have a significant impact on lightweight floor impact noise. However, research on floor finishing materials is currently lacking. In this study, as a basic research on the development of various floor finishing materials for effective reduction of lightweight floor impact noise, various materials used as floor finishing materials for apartment complexes were selected, the sound insulation performance of lightweight floor impact noise was measured in an actual laboratory, and vibration characteristics were identified through simple experiments. The purpose was to confirm the predictability of light floor impact noise.

Meteorological Constraints and Countermeasures in Major Summer Crop Production (하작물의 기상재해와 그 대책)

  • Summer crops grown in uplands are greatly diversified and show a large variation in difference with year and location in Korea. The principal factor for the variation is weather, in which precipitation and temperature play a leading role and such a weather factors as wind, sun lights also influence production of the summer crops. Since artificial control of weather conditions as a main stress factor for crop production is almost impossible, it must be minimized only by an improvement of cultivation techniques and crop improvement. Precipitation plays a role as one of the most important factor for production of the summer crops and it is considered in two aspects, drought and excess moisture. This country, which belongs to monsoon territory, necessarily encounter one of this stress almost every year, even though the level is different. Therefore, the facilities for both drought and excess moisture are required, but actually it is not easy to complete for them. On this account, crops tolerant to drought, excess moisture and pests should be considered for establishing summer crops. For the districts damaged habitually every season, adequate crops should be cultured and appropriate method of planting, drainage and weed control should be applied diversely. Injuries by temperature is mainly attributed to lower temperature particularly in late fall and early spring, although higher temperature often causes some damages depending upon the kind of crops. Sometimes, lower temperature in summer season playa critical role for yield reduction in the summer crops. However, certain crops are prevented to some extent from this kind of stress by improving varieties tolerant to cold, hot weather or early maturing varieties. As is often the case, control of planting time or harvesting is able to be a good management for escaping the stress. Lodging, plant diseases and pests are considered as a direct or indirect damage due to weather stress, but these are characters able to be overcome by means of crop improvement and also controlled by other suitable methods. In addition, polytical supports capable of improving constitution of agriculture into modern industry is urgently required by programming of data for the damages, establishment of damage forecasting and compensation system.
